The Glass-reinforced Substrate Market is booming, with a projected value of USD 1.60 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 3.98% from 2026-2033. The U.S. market is expected to reach USD 0.29 billion, driven by the demand for lightweight, high-performance materials across various industries like electronics, automotive, and aerospace. Leading players include AGC Inc., SKC, and Corning Incorporated.

In terms of industry segmentation, the market is led by the 0.1 mm – 0.5 mm thickness segment and Printed Circuit Boards (PCBs) application, with Glass-Reinforced Epoxy Laminates leading the type category. Consumer Electronics holds the largest market share, with Asia Pacific dominating the market due to strong PCB and semiconductor manufacturing.

Recent news includes AGC’s glass substrates for AR/MR glasses receiving an award in the CES 2025 Innovation Awards program and SKC’s subsidiary, Absolics, starting prototype production of glass substrates in Georgia.
